The warmth continued on Bigg Boss 19 , where the two appeared together again, promoting their respective projects. In a particularly viral moment, they took a playful dig at Ajay Devgn's dancing skills. As they danced to their song "Odhli Chunariya," from their 1998 film, Kajol jokingly warned the audience, "Don't attempt this at home, it's dangerous for your mental health". These appearances showcased a shift from a tense past to a playful present.

is the mascot of the "mass" hero. From his Dabangg era onward, his entertainment content has been defined by a specific formula: a chiseled physique, a signature bracelet, dialogue delivery that borders on a lazy drawl, and a paradoxical blend of violent righteousness and childlike innocence. His brand is aspirational and unapologetically commercial. Whether it’s Bajrangi Bhaijaan or Tiger Zinda Hai , Salman’s media persona revolves around the idea of the "God’s man"—a savior who breaks rules but never hearts.
